Verstehen der Kolorierung von Code in VEXcode IQ Python

Beim Erstellen von Textprojekten sind Syntax, Abstand, Einrückung und Rechtschreibung in Ihrem Code sehr wichtig, um sicherzustellen, dass Ihr Projekt wie vorgesehen ausgeführt wird. Die im Arbeitsbereich in VEXcode IQ Python vorhandene Farbcodierung ist ein zusätzlicher visueller Hinweis darauf, dass Sie Ihren Code korrekt in Ihr Projekt eingegeben haben.

Wenn beim Eingeben von Befehlen in den Arbeitsbereich eine nicht erkennbare Komponente vorhanden ist, bleibt diese schwarz (wie die vom Benutzer erstellte Kategorie). Dies kann ein nützlicher Indikator sein, wenn Sie später Frustrationen oder zusätzliche Fehlerbehebungen vermeiden möchten.

Verwenden Sie den Cursor und die Tastatur, um Fehler zu korrigieren. Sobald die Komponenten erkannt werden, werden sie korrekt eingefärbt.

Die Einfärbung von Code folgt den folgenden Konventionen:

Klassen

Klassen.png

Das einzelne Gerät, auf das sich der Befehl bezieht (z. B. Antrieb, Stift, Gehirn)

Befehle

Befehle.png

Das Verhalten innerhalb des Befehls (z. B. Fahren, Drehen)

Parameter

Parameter.png

Informationen darüber, wie das Verhalten ausgeführt wird (z. B. Richtung, Entfernung)

Strukturen

Strukturen.png

Steuern Sie den Fluss des Projekts (z. B. Bedingungen, Schleifen).

Werte

Werte.png

Dem Verhalten zugeordneter numerischer Parameter (z. B. Gradzahl einer Drehung)

Vom Benutzer erstellt

User_Created.png

Vom Benutzer erstellte Variablen und Befehle

Kommentare

Kommentare.png

Der Text nach einem #, der keine Auswirkungen auf das Programm hat.

For more information, help, and tips, check out the many resources at VEX Professional Development Plus

Last Updated: